****Estra, Tosa. Dyer Castle****
****Vlad POV****
"Hello, are you there?"
I heard Aaron's voice and got out of my own world and looked at him.
"Ah, yes. I am sorry, I was just thinking about something. Can you repeat what you said?"
"That's fine. I just wanted to tell you that we won't get the contract from my father until evening, so you can do what you want" he replied.
"That's fine. I wanted to look around the city anyway" I said as I put down the cup I was holding.
"Then, please take this" He said as he handed me a medallion with a tiger engraved on it. I looked up at him.
"What is this?"
"Show this to anyone who wants to make trouble for you" he said and left the room.
I stood up and walked out of the door. While walking through the corridor, I saw the 3 people who were with Aaron last time we met. This time, though, they acted very politely towards me.
I walked out of the castle.
I started walking around the city and watched how things were in it.
Although it was not as fancy as earth, it sure surprised me with the amount of people who carried weapons on their back or waist.
Looking at these people who were all Cultivators made me really happy because on earth, not everyone was a fighter and those who were, were in the professional league or in some sort of club, but here, everyone was a fighter, be it women or men.
I was a former Kung Fu master on earth and I even beat the shit out of the people who thought that they were at the top of the martial arts world.
"Leave my sister alone" I heard the voice of a boy and turned to my right.
I saw that there were 5 men surrounding a small boy and a girl. They both looked about 8-10 years old.
The boy was blocking the way of the 5 men who were standing in front of him.
I looked at the men and saw that 4 of them wore the same black ragged clothes.
The 4 men were all at the height of 200-210 cm and they had a lot of scars on their body. They carried swords that were made of steel. The hilts had three pieces to them, a simple crosspiece, a square ‘scent stopper’ pommel with 4 citrines set in it, and a ribbed grip made of ebony. A single rune (a dagger plunged through a heart made of thin clear lines) is carved into the middle of its back. The swords were about 1m in length.

The fifth man was fat and was at the height of 170 cm. He wore a golden robe and looked just like a noble.
"Get out of my way kid, or else don't blame me for being merciless!" Pig 1 said [Can’t be bothered to name them so I will just call them Pig 1-4. Very Happy]
"I won't let you take my sister!" the kid yelled as the girl behind him started to cry.
"Just get rid of the kid and get her!" the fat man said as he was getting impatient.
I just realized what was going on. ‘Slave traders’ I thought
I looked around to see if there was anyone who would help them, but everyone was just pretending that they are not seeing this at all. Most people here just made quick glances towards the scene and looked at the kids with pity before facing the other way.
I started to move towards them which made a lot of people look at me with surprised expressions.
‘Are you going to play the hero?’ I heard Dyton's voice in my head.
‘Why would I do that?’ I replied back to him.
‘Then, why are you going towards them?’
‘To check how much stronger I have become after getting to the Mortal rank!’ I said in my mind as my eyes lit up and my lips curved up into a smile.
"Get lost kid!" the man raised his hand to push the kid out of the way. The kid looked at the man without a single hint of fear as the warrior brought his hand down towards the kid and was about hit the boy.
"Huh?" Pig 1 was surprised as well as the other pigs and the Pig Lord.
"How about you spar with me?" I said while holding his hand. His face went from being surprised to pale as he realized that I was crushing his bone. This came to me as a surprise as well. I have only used 50% of my strength and the bone was about break.
*Crack!*
"Ahhhhhhhh" you could hear the screams of the man as his bone broke and he held his broken hand with his other while getting down on his knees.
"Get this man!" the Pig Lord said and the other 3 pigs got out of their shocked daze and took out their swords.
‘Take the man's sword!’ I heard Dyton's voice and I kicked the kneeling man in the face and stole his sword.
Right now, we are in front of a shop and the arena around us is a free space as people cleared it out and gathered on the corners looking at us.

After picking up the heavy looking sword, I realized that it was very light. The length bothered me a lot, though. I am only 174 cm and the sword was 1m long, it was too long, but I had no choice at that moment.
"Kill him!" the Pig Lord yelled and the 3 men launched themselves at me
I dodged the first sword strike of the first pig and elbowed him which caused him to take 4 steps back before stopping and spitting out a mouthful of blood.
I looked towards the 2 others’ swords right above my head. To cope with it, I used my sword as a shield.
*Clang**Clang*
I blocked both swords and took a step back and stopped. Then, I moved forward again and swung my sword in an arc shape towards the pig to the right.
*Bang*
The sound of metallic clashing could be heard and the man flew backwards due to the power behind my weapon before dropping to the ground.
*Pu*
The man spat out a mouthful of blood as he fainted. Then, I moved my legs to the right and my sword towards the left and blocked the sword coming from the that direction.
*Clang*
My sword started to vibrate due to the clash of the weapons.
*Clang*
*Clang*
*Clang*
We both swung our swords really fast. One clash after the other could be heard throughout the area. I received wounds from the man but so did the he.
This man knew that If he took one sword hit from me, then he would probably lose so he kept avoiding the strikes like a snake.
I moved back from the warrior. I knew that he is faster than me which is why I haven't been able to attack him at all. He made me go into defensive mode as he kept sending one strike after another. ‘This Pig 4 is amazing!’ I thought
My blood was boiling.
How long has it been since I had a fight like this!?
The man ran towards me and jumped as he swung his sword down trying to kill me. I quickly rolled over and swung my sword sideways.
*Bang*
The man blocked it and took a step back. I quickly ran after him as I jumped as well and swung my weapon towards him.
He didn't get his balance yet before the sword hit him. I looked to the right and saw that there was a sword coming towards me. I quickly pulled my sword into shield mode.
*BANG*
The sword hit my own one and I flew 5 steps backwards before stopping. Then, I stood up and to my surprise, this didn't affect my body at all. I felt just a small numbness in my hands that was was gone after a while. Both of the men looked towards me and ran.
They each came from two different directions. In this kind of situation, the only way to get out of it is if I run forward the moment their swords are swung.
‘You put every Sword Immortal into shame!’ Dyton's voice boomed in my head.
‘What do you mean?’ I asked, confused.
‘Use the fucking Sword Energy around you!’
‘Sword Energy? You mean the sharp things around me?’
‘Yes’
I closed my eyes and I made the Sword Energy around me enter my body then the sword in my hand.
I opened my eyes and saw the two swords coming at me.
The speed they were moving at slowed down which allowed me to swing at both of them.
As they both saw the incoming attack, their faces lost their red color and they went pale while their eyes showed fear and despair.
*BOOM*
You could hear an explosion coming from my sword as they both flew backwards with wounds all over their bodis and the light in their eyes seemed to have dimmed down.
I felt that my entire body was in pain but that didn't make me go down, it just made me stand up proudly.
My eyes were blazing with fire and my smile was radiating. Coupled with my red hair and yellow eyes, this made everyone watching speechless. I looked just like a War God who has descended on the mortal world.
I looked around the place and saw the 4 men who were down. As I swept my gaze over the many people watching, I saw that they all had an 'o' shaped mouth.
My gaze fell on the fat man and I moved forward.
"D-don't come any closer!" the fat man yelled as he fell on his ass, his face bleak.
I moved my sword upwards and swung it down, cutting the man in half. Blood and guts were seen on the ground and I got blood all over my white robe. I threw the blade down on the ground and made my way through the crowd.
I thought that after killing 3 men, I would feel something, but I felt nothing. This showed me that my personality really changed.
